Claims
- 1. A liposome containing an active agent, said liposome comprising:
- (a) a lipid unilaminar bilayer comprising phospholipid, lipid surfactant with a Critical Micelle Concentration (CMC) of about 1 millimolar or less, and from 3 mole percent to 60 mole percent of cholesterol; and
- (b) a micellar preparation comprising active agent aggregated with the lipid surfactant to form micelles, said micelles entrapped within the interior space of the liposome;
- and said cholesterol is contained in the lipid bilayer in an amount sufficient to increase the stability of the micelle-containing liposome compared to that which would occur in the absence of cholesterol.
- 2. A liposome according to claim 1, wherein said lipid bilayer further comprises active agent associated with the lipid bilayer.
- 3. A liposome according to claim 1, wherein said phospholipid is stearoyloleoylphosphatidylcholine (SOPC).
- 4. A liposome according to claim 1, wherein said surfactant is a lysolipid.
- 5. A liposome according to claim 1, wherein said surfactant is a lysophosphatidylcholine.
- 6. A liposome according to claim 1, wherein said surfactant is monooleyolphosphatidylcholine (MOPC).
- 7. A liposome according to claim 1, wherein said active agent is paclitaxel.
- 8. A liposome according to claim 7, wherein paclitaxel is contained in the liposome in an amount of at least 7 mol % relative to SOPC.
- 9. A liposome according to claim 1, said lipid bilayer further comprising polymer-derivatized lipids.
- 10. A liposome according to claim 9, wherein said polymer is polyethylene glycol.
- 11. A liposome according to claim 1, wherein said lipid bilayer comprises phospholipid, cholesterol and surfactant in a mole ratio of about 8:4:3.
- 12. A liposome containing paclitaxel, said liposome comprising:
- (a) a lipid unilaminar bilayer comprising phospholipid, lysophosphatidylcholine, and cholesterol in a mole ratio of about 8:4:3, and
- (b) a micellar preparation comprising paclitaxel aggregated with lysophosphatidylcholine micelles, said micelles entrapped within the interior space of the liposome.
- 13. A liposome according to claim 12, further comprising paclitaxel associated with the lipid bilayer.
- 14. A liposome according to claim 13, wherein said phospholipid is SOPC and wherein paclitaxel is contained in the liposome in an amount of at least 7 mol % relative to SOPC.
